Intermolecular forces

    Cards (5)

    • Boiling Point
      the temperature at which vapour pressure is equal to atmospheric pressure o The stronger the intermolecular forces, the higher the boiling point
    • Melting Point
      The temperature at which the solid and liquid phases of s substance are at equilibrium o The stronger the intermolecular forces, the higher the melting point
    • Vapour Pressure
      The pressure exerted by a vapour at equilibrium with its liquid in a closed system. o The stronger the intermolecular forces, the lower the vapour pressure.
